Runbook 14-C: The Halvorsen mantel clock is to be crated by Verrow Freight and sent to the Pellam Horology Workshop for escapement repair. Records team must log the crate seal number before departure and file the condition photographs the same day. The courier hand-over instruction for this consignment is as follows.

dispatch memo: the quenax olidor courier leaves the lamvan aldath keliel ledger at gate 2085 under passcode 005795

Welcome to the SeatScape review rotation! SeatScape renders the seat map for the Gildervane Playhouse booking flow, so keep an eye on SVG diffs — tiny coordinate changes can shift whole balconies. Before you can approve merges, you'll need access to the staging vault where render fixtures live. The vault unlocks with the team recovery passphrase, shown below.

unlock words, hahip-yagef: zorok-novmir-zorix-silax

### Rendering hot path

Support keeps flagging slow page loads on Cartavine's invoice templates. Root cause: the Lumora renderer re-parses partials on every request when the fragment cache is cold. Fix shipped in 4.2: compiled templates are memoized, cache keys include locale, and eviction is LRU with a hard entry cap. If a customer reports latency over 400ms, check cache hit rate first. Do not raise the cap without checking heap headroom on shared tenants. Current tuning values are as follows.

tuning constants:
QUOTAS = {
    "druwyn": 5,
    "holix": 5,
    "zorath": 5,
    "holwyn": 10,
}